IPL 2025: Hardik Pandya to Lead Mumbai Indians Amidst High Expectations

Published on

KKN Gurugram Desk | The Indian Premier League (IPL) 2025 season is just around the corner, and there’s growing excitement among cricket fans as teams begin to solidify their strategies for the upcoming season. Mumbai Indians, one of the most successful franchises in IPL history, has once again placed its trust in Hardik Pandya as their captain. This comes after a challenging 2024 season for the team, which saw Mumbai Indians fail to meet the expectations of their loyal fanbase. With the leadership of Pandya, the franchise aims to bounce back stronger and reclaim their spot at the top.

Hardik Pandya’s Leadership in IPL 2024

In the 2024 IPL season, Mumbai Indians made the bold decision to appoint Hardik Pandya as the captain. This decision was a major shift for the franchise, as they had previously relied on seasoned leaders like Rohit Sharma. However, Pandya’s leadership qualities, combined with his explosive batting and strategic mind, made him an ideal candidate for the role. Unfortunately, the 2024 season did not go as planned for Mumbai Indians.

Despite having a strong squad, Mumbai struggled with consistency, leading to their disappointing performance throughout the season. The team’s batting, despite the presence of powerful hitters like Ishan Kishan and Suryakumar Yadav, failed to fire at the right moments. The bowling department also lacked the necessary depth, which hampered their ability to compete with other top teams in the league.
